My system died and I swaped mine at Gamestop for a new one but I kept my hard drive, and when I put the hard drive in my new system, all of my purchased XBL Arcade games were only playable if I was signed into XBL.  I was able to play the trial versions only.  I'm still unable to play the ones I purchased prior to the system dying without being signed on XBL.  I'm going to call MS about this, as I've heard of people having this issue, and supposedly they complained enough and MS gave them a code to use or something to take care of this problem.

I hope this works because this is really annoying.
